5 out of 5 stars Glorious!   January 14, 2008
 10 out of 11 found this review helpful

The copy of this Book, that I grew up with was my Father's 1945 Paperback Edition. As a Kid, I was drawn in to these amazing Cartoons by Bill. When I was about 13, I read the Text to this Great Book, and was Blown Away by it! In my view, Bill Mauldin has written the Most Honest Account of World War II that you are gonna find. From a Dogface's Point-Of-View, this Book is a History Lesson for all of us.

War is indeed a Tragic Thing, and it is still Real in 2008. But to be Honest about it AND to be able still Laugh, This is what makes: "Up Front", such a special Book for me. It reminds me of my Pop, who served in Patton's Third Armored from 1943-1945. My Dad loved a Good Paperback, and through his Bookshelf, I was able to Discover some Fantastic Stuff, but from Mark Twain to Steinbeck, this is my Favorite from his Collection.

The Muddy Faces of Willie and Joe are the faces of Millions of American Veterans of World War II. These were our Father's and Grandfather's, this is the Story of those GI's....From their Muddy Foxholes...FIVE STARS !!!

4 out of 5 stars Up Front, Bill Mauldin.   September 14, 2007
 1 out of 1 found this review helpful


Bill by his own admission is a cartoonist not a writer, and he is correct, and to me that is great.
In this book he explains why he drew his cartoons, what was going on at the time, etc.
There is probably no more miserable life than that of the Soldier or Marine infantryman in combat. Sometimes living like an animal is a step up.
Complaining is as normal for an infantryman as breathing, it is what keeps them alive, Mauldin brings this out.
If one wants to know the life of an infantryman in a digestable way this is it. A great read, not deep, but great.
